Forgive the double post, but I just thought of something - can someone please clarify/confirm this for me?

The drivers who have fresh engines but didn't retire in Bahrain (TGF, Coulthard & Massa) will go through qualifying, and assuming they make it through to the final session, will now be able to set a lap time running on petrol fumes, then fill up before the grand prix due to them starting outside the top 10.

To me it seems like a minor glitch/loophole in the rules.
